The Study Of Bone Marrow Around The Knee Joint On MRI

Objective: To observe the feature of different age around the knee joint bone red and yellow marrow and analyze the distribution of red and yellow marrow around the knee joint on MRI T1 W I and PDWI-FS.Methods: PDWI-FS and T1 WI of the knee joint in 67 subject, male 27, female, 40. The subjects with no known bone marrow abnormalities were divided into five age groups. To observe the femoral distal metaphysis and epiphysis,tibial proximal metaphysis and epiphysis, fibula proximal metaph- ysis and epiphysis of several regional bone marrow signal intensity, With the same level of subcutaneous fat and adjacent muscle signal as the referen- ce, according to the T1 WI image classification of bone marrow signal inten- sity.Results:The signal intensity of bone marrow in distal femoral meta- physis and tibia and fibula proximal metaphysis were grades 0-1and the signal intensity of bone marrow in epiphysis was grades 3 in group A.In group B,the signal intensity of bone marrow in distal femoral metaphysis was grades 1-3,including 3 cases of grade 3, for the rest of 1~2;The signal intensity of bone marrow in tibia and fibula proximal metaphysis were grades 2-3, including 6 cases of grade 3, for the rest of 2; the signal intensity of bone marrow in epiphysis was grades 3-4. In group C,the signal intensity of bone marrow in distal femoral metaphysis was grades 1-3,including 3 cases of grade 3 and 2 cases of grade 1, The signal intensity of bone marrow in tibia and fibula proximal metaphysis were grades 2-4.In group D,the signal intensity of bone marrow in distal femoral metaphysis and tibia and fibula proximal metaphysis were grades 3-4, 3and4 level signal ratio is about 1/1;In group E,the signal intensity of bone marrow in distal femor- al metaphysis and tibia and fibula proximal metaphysis were grades 3-4, the signal intensity of bone marrow in epiphysis was grades 3-4.Patellar ossification centers appear in 2 to 5 years old,the signal intensity of bone marrow in patellar was grades 3-4.Conclusions:1 The distal femoral metaphysis appear yellow marrow began in 6 to 10 years of age,11 to 15 years for the bone marrow into the significant period of time, 16 to 20 years of age most subjects red bone marrow into yellow bone marrow,21 to 25 years of age to complete the transformation to the yellow bo- ne marrow.2 The proximal tibial metaphysis in 5 years ago are red bone marrow, in 6to 10 years of age began to transform to the Yellow bone marrow, converse- on start time than the distal femoral metaphysis of about 1~2ears earlier, began to transformation of the completion of 16 to 20 years old, converted the emergence time of distal femoral metaphysis than early about 1~2years of age. 21 years later the bone marrow is basically uniform yellow bone marr- ow signal.3 Fibula proximal metaphyseal marrow conversion and proximal tibial metaphyseal marrow conversion are basically the same.4 Proximal fibular epiphysis appears time between 2 to 5 years old, after yellow marrow mainly; around the knee epiphyseal bone marrow are mai-nly yellow bone marrow.5 In this study, 1 cases of proximal tibial metaphysis yellow bone marrow within the residual red bone marrow island.
